I have to do some wiring cleanup so please forgive the mess, lol. Red Sea sends an ato fill tank that sits over the filter socks, that was not gonna happen so I had a piece of glass cut that sits on the same supports to minimize any potential splashing or salt spray.

View attachment 17904

I'm using the Autoaqua Smart ATO Micro this go around, I usually use the full size. You can see the feed coming in from the back of the tank. Marinepure spheres in baffle and a block in the skimmer chamber. Decided to try out a Reef Octopus skimmer this go around, time will tell if it gets my approval.
